The Yolka interceptor, a system designed to counter unmanned aerial vehicles, has been analyzed in a recent Forbes article highlighting its mixed operational profile. The system reportedly provides a degree of protection to Russian soldiers on the ground. However, its reliance on a kinetic-kill mechanism—which physically destroys incoming drones rather than using electronic warfare or other means—may pose effectiveness challenges, particularly against fast-moving or swarming drone tactics. Furthermore, the article points to low production quantities as a key limiting factor, suggesting that even if the Yolka performs well in isolated engagements, insufficient numbers could prevent widespread deployment across defensive positions. The combination of design choice and production constraints could therefore reduce the overall impact of the system on the battlefield, leaving vulnerabilities that adversaries might exploit. The kinetic-kill approach, while traditional, may be less adaptable to evolving drone threats that employ small size, low cost, and coordinated attacks. Low production volumes could reflect either supply chain bottlenecks, resource allocation priorities, or extended development timelines. These factors might indicate broader systemic issues within the Russian defense industrial base, possibly affecting investor sentiment toward companies involved in similar counter-drone projects. Additionally, the reported constraints could shift attention toward alternative defensive systems, such as electronic jamming or directed-energy weapons, which may offer more scalable solutions.
